I have a flight booked tomorrow for Tel Aviv to Beirut (via Istanbul). As Israel does not stamp passports anymore at Ben Gurion, I have no indication that I have been to Israel on my documents. I am planning on checking a bag, but picking up with the bag separately from Istanbul and rechecking it to Beirut. This will make it so I have no tag on my luggage indiciating that I have been to Israel.

I have a couple of questions that are causing me anxiety: will I be asked for my airline tickets for the journey going there or the journey going back? Are there any other things that could cause me trouble on this trip that I am over looking? Can I expect to recieve trouble from passport control?

I am an American passport holder, by the way.
